摘要
在对双螺杆磨浆机传动系统的结构设计方案进行可行性分析的基础上,对传动系统的结构进行了具体设计,并利用Unigraphics NX 4.0软件对减速器进行了三维参数化实体造型、零部件设计及虚拟装配,再现整个减速器的真实情况,完成了减速器各零部件装配过程干涉检查。
The design idea of using the double circular tooth gear to substitute involute in transmission system of BIVIS was proposed. The 3D modeling, virtual design of the parts, virtual assemble and interference of the reducer were completed by using Unigraphies NX 4. 0.
